Sari Pollack

As the Manager of Ad Sales and Content Marketing for AMC, Sari Pollack is responsible for supporting the network’s revenue goals by leading the logistical management of the yearly Upfront meetings as well as building brand awareness around AMC’s original series through the creation, development and production of network premiums aimed at the ad sales community.  In this role, she has worked on both scripted and unscripted original series which include the Emmy® Award-winning Mad Men, Breaking Bad and The Walking Dead. 

 

Joining the network in 1996, Sari has participated in the network’s transformation from a black and white, commercial-free movie channel to the network that boasts the most-watched drama series in basic cable history which currently airs the #1 show on television among adults 18-49 with The Walking Dead

 

Prior to joining AMC, Ms. Pollack starting in advertising working for Waring and LaRosa on both the AMC and WE tv brand (formerly known as Romance Classics) as well as Montblanc and Perrier Group of America accounts. 

Sari holds both an MBA and BBA from Hofstra University with a concentration in Marketing.  She resides in New York, but is originally from Massachusetts.
